    碎尸万段 / 碎屍萬段

    suì​shī​wàn​duàn

    to tear to pieces

    (idiom) to cut or tear someone's body into thousands of pieces; used as a hyperbolic threat to kill someone or an expression of extreme hatred; to inflict severe punishment

    碎尸 (literal) → 碎尸/碎屍 · suì​shī · dismembered corpse 万 (literal) → 万/萬 · wàn · countless 段 (literal) → 段 · duàn · to cut off
